Frame Repair and Restoration
As with every other part of the house window frames are prone to damage. It doesn't matter if it's due to extreme weather, insects or unruly hits from baseball or cricket bats, a damaged frame can seriously detract from the appearance and health of your home. While replacing your entire frame might seem as the most efficient option, a window specialist can fix frames that are damaged even in places that are difficult to reach such as upper floors or dormers.
Window repair specialists can repair damaged sills, hinges, and locks. They can even replace rotten wood and ensure that the new work is compatible with the original materials used in the construction of your home. They will also ensure that the new frame fits correctly and make any adjustments needed to ensure that the window or door opens and closes correctly.
If the damage to your frame is severe, it may be necessary to completely rebuild or replace the window. A specialist company can construct new frames for a fraction of what it would cost to replace them, and they make use of authentic materials that match the architectural style of your home. They also provide a range of finishing services, like oil sizing and water gilding in 23k gold.

Car Window Repair
It is imperative to act swiftly when your car window is damaged. If you leave a damaged car window open, your vehicle is vulnerable to the elements as well as wildlife and criminal intention. A professional can replace the windshield or window of your vehicle in a matter of minutes. This will help prevent further damage to your vehicle.
A lot of auto insurance policies cover windshield replacements free of charge to the insured driver. You must meet the requirements of your auto insurance company, and the type of vehicle you drive. For example, some insurers will only pay for windscreen repair or replacement only if it's covered by the comprehensive part of your policy.
Before you contact a window doctor near me, it's important to get rid of the glass shards and any other debris that may have fallen inside your vehicle. A powerful vacuum cleaner is the best choice to remove even the smallest glass fragments. Also, you should clean the window frame if possible. It isn't possible to completely eliminate all shards. However, cleaning them as much as you can will prevent further damage.
Auto glass and windshield specialists evaluate damaged windows to determine whether they can be repaired. They use special tools for small chips and cracks to ensure that they don't cause further damage. If a glass window isn't repaired, it is replaced. They use an adhesive to ensure that the glass is securely in the frame. They also apply an Urethane sealant on the edges of the window to keep out moisture.
Window and windshield specialists can also assist with other glass-related issues. As airborne particles impact the glass at high speeds they can cause micro-pits or pits to form on the surface. These issues can affect your vision, and also affect the ability to see road signs and other cars. A specialist can restore a clear windshield by smoothing out the glass.
Certain of these specialists provide mobile repair of car glass. You can save time and money by having them visit your office or home. They can work on your vehicle in a parking space or another outdoor location.
